Lil Wayne

Dwayne Michael Carter Jr., known professionally as Lil Wayne, is an American rapper, singer, songwriter, record executive, entrepreneur, and actor. His career began in 1996, at the age of 13, when he was discovered by Birdman and joined Cash Money Records as the youngest member of the label.

Mark Wahlberg

Mark Robert Michael Wahlberg is an American actor, producer, businessman, model, rapper, singer and songwriter. He is also known by his former stage name Marky Mark, from his career as frontman for the group, Marky Mark and the Funky Bunch, with whom he released the albums Music for the People and You Gotta Believe.

Gemma Arterton

Gemma Christina Arterton is an English actress, activist and film producer. She made her stage debut playing Rosaline in Shakespeare’s Love’s Labour’s Lost at the Globe Theatre, and first appeared on film in the comedy St Trinian’s.

Sydney Sweeney

Sydney Sweeney is an American actress. She appeared in the Netflix series Everything Sucks! and has taken on recurring roles in the Hulu series The Handmaid’s Tale and the HBO miniseries Sharp Objects. In 2019, she began starring in the HBO teen drama series Euphoria.

Nina Dobrev

Nikolina Kamenova Dobreva, known professionally as Nina Dobrev, is a Canadian actress and model. Her first acting role was as Mia Jones in the drama series Degrassi: The Next Generation. She later became known for portraying Elena Gilbert and Katherine Pierce on The CW’s supernatural drama series The Vampire Diaries.

Camila Cabello

Karla Camila Cabello Estrabao is a Cuban-American singer, songwriter, and actress. She rose to prominence as a member of the girl group Fifth Harmony, formed on The X Factor USA in 2012, signing a joint record deal with Syco Music and Epic Records.

Katherine McNamara

Katherine Grace McNamara is an American actress. She is known for her lead role as Clary Fray on the 2016–2019 Freeform fantasy series Shadowhunters. McNamara joined the cast of Arrow, starting with its seventh season, playing the character of Mia Smoak, the daughter of Oliver Queen and Felicity Smoak.
